  Defensive tackle Marcus Miller is out of practice to have an arthroscopic knee procedure, dropping the 6-5, 286-pound junior from Warren off the 110-man camp roster. Logan Horst, a 6-4, 255-pound senior transfer from Nebraska Wesleyan, was added to fill his spot. Coach Sam Pittman sounded confident Miller, who was off to a good start, would return fairly soon. "It is disappointing because he works so hard and he was doing well," Pittman said. "But you're looking at a, I believe, and I mean this, I believe that he'll be back no later than when school starts. "So I think he'll have two weeks before the Cincinnati game. He had a little clean-out in his knee and that was it. Marcus had been having a good 3-4 days. He's got a good attitude that serves him well, so I anticipate him being back probably the first day of school." - Northwest Arkansas Times
